In 1990, Warner Chappell, a music holding company, bought the rights to the … Web2 nov. 2024 · Most common examples sell in the $3 to $5 range today in antique malls and sometimes for even less via internet auctions. For instance, it's not uncommon to find lots of 25 to 30 pieces of sheet music selling online for $10 or less for the entire lot. Most common pieces have to be in excellent condition to bring even that much.
